2024-2025 Program Monitoring Validations Process Statewide Virtual Training
The Federal Program Compliance Division will be conducting programmatic monitoring of the following federal programs authorized under the Elementary and Secondary Education Act (ESEA), as amended by the Every Student Succeeds Act (ESSA) in the 2024-2025 grant year.
- Title I, Part A - Improving Basic Programs
- Title I, Part C - Education of Migratory Children
- Title I, Part D, Subpart 2 - Prevention and Intervention Programs for Children and Youth Who Are Neglected, Delinquent, or At-Risk
- Title II, Part A - Supporting Effective Instruction
- Title IV, Part A - Student Support and Academic Enrichment
- ESSA Private Nonprofit School Equitable Services (PNP)
In preparation for the 2024-2025 Program Monitoring Validations process, the Federal Program Compliance Division (FPC) will provide a statewide virtual training. Information related to the LEA programmatic monitoring process the Division will use in 2024-2025 will be provided in the session. Participants will learn about the parameters for LEA selection, the programs included in the monitoring process, the requirements selected for documentation review, and process timelines. Additionally, resources will be shared, and time will be allotted for questions. Captions auto-generated by the Zoom platform will be made available during the virtual training. There is no cost to attend the training. A link to access the recording and handouts will be posted to the Statewide Training Series webpage after the training.
Additional information related to the 2024-2025 Program Monitoring Validations process will be announced via Statewide News Bulletin in mid-September.
